Palatine American Legion to Host Casino Night
The Palatine American Legion Post 690 is holding a casino night which is open to the public on Friday, September 12th.

The Palatine American Legion Post 690 is holding a casino night which is open to the public on Friday, September 12th at the newly renovated American Legion Hall 122 West Palatine Road in Palatine to raise funds for Legion Family Charities.
“Come out between 5:00 PM and Midnight, play some poker, some of our other games of chance and have some fun,” said Matt Christie, casino night Project Chairman. “For a $5.00 entry fee you’ll be able to enjoy cash games of poker, Blackjack, Texas Hold’Em, Over & Under Dice Roll and Money Wheel in our hall. You’ll get to see our brand new, totally renovated hall. Come by for a few minutes or stay for a few hours!”
A full service bar will be open upstairs for the casino night and another full service bar will be open downstairs in the clubroom. “Our goal is to make these friendly neighborhood games,” said Christie. “We encourage camaraderie between the players as well as with their dealers.”

The most notable of the American Legion’s projects is the annual Memorial Day program. The program encompasses the parade, the laying of wreaths at two of Palatine’s war memorials and a program at Community Park. The American Legion, as part of Legion Charities, also conducts bingo for blind veterans several times a year, hosts a Thanksgiving party for sailors from Great Lakes Naval Training Center and brings gifts to veterans during visits to Hines V. A. Hospital in Hines, Illinois.
The American Legion and Legion Auxiliary began in 1919 while the Sons of the American Legion was created in 1932 as patriotic veterans organizations devoted to mutual helpfulness. These organizations are committed to mentoring and sponsorship of youth programs in our communities, advocating patriotism and honor, promoting a strong national security, and continued devotion to our fellow service members and veterans.
